Quick summary
Creating test scripts in Jira requires a test management add-on like Xray, which adds a dedicated Testing Board and structured test case creation to your Jira project. Once set up, you can define test case details, set priority and labels, and save your test script directly within Jira.
Steps
- Navigate to your desired Jira project.
- Select the Testing Board from the sidebar of your project.
- Click Create and select Test from the dropdown.
- Enter a name and description to define your test case details.
- Set additional fields including Priority, Labels, and Test Type.
- Click Create to save your test case as a test script.
- Note: test script creation in Jira is most effectively managed using Xray, which provides structured test case management features.
